Since the late 90s, the Niger Delta of the Federal Republic of Nigeria has been faced with many ecological threats. These include cholera outbreak, Lassa fever, oil spillage, black soot and flooding, among others. However, this essay focuses on black soot, oil spillage and flooding in four communities in Rivers State, one of the six states in the Niger Delta. These communities are most affected among the state's total of over one hundred. Their names are Aluu, Rumuolumeni, and K-Dere.

Elastic Optical Networks (EONs) allow to solve the high demand for bandwidth due to the increase in the number of internet users and the explosion of multicast applications. To support multicast applications, network operator computes a tree-shaped path, which is a set of optical channels. Generally, the demand for bandwidth on an optical channel is enormous so that, if there is a single fiber failure, it could cause a serious interruption in data transmission and a huge loss of data. To avoid serious interruption in data transmission, the tree-shaped path of a multicast connection may be protected. Several works have been proposed methods to do this. But these works may cause the duplication of some resources after recovery due to a link failure. Therefore, this duplication can lead to inefficient use of network resources. Our work consists to propose a method of protection that eliminates the link that causes duplication so that, the final backup path structure after link failure is a tree. Evaluations and analyses have shown that our method uses less backup resources than methods for protection of a multicast connection.

This study investigated the effects of reading while listening (RWL) and reading only (RO) modes on learners’ reading comprehension and perceptions. A total of 157 Japanese high school learners of English as a foreign language (EFL) participated in this study. All the participants read four reading passages: two passages with RWL mode and two passages with RO mode. The participants were also divided into three different proficiency groups based on their vocabulary levels test score. The findings showed that the high and medium proficiency groups scored higher, regardless of having audio support or not. By contrast, the low proficiency group scored higher with RWL mode than with RO mode. The results of a questionnaire related to learners’ perceptions supported the view that the low group benefitted more from RWL mode compared to the other two groups. These findings indicated that learners’ vocabulary levels and two reading modes affected their reading performance differently. Furthermore, the findings show that the simultaneous reading and listening mode is an effective method to develop reading skills and motivation toward reading, especially for low proficiency learners.
